diff src/audacious/ui_skinned_window.h @ 2496:71bee08db1c6 trunk

[svn] - widgetlist -> SkinnedWindow class + basic conversion in ui_main, other skinned windows remain
author nenolod
date Sat, 10 Feb 2007 20:09:23 -0800
parents 59661bd074b4
children 319b10203d7c
line wrap: on
line diff
--- a/src/audacious/ui_skinned_window.h	Sat Feb 10 17:04:31 2007 -0800
+++ b/src/audacious/ui_skinned_window.h	Sat Feb 10 20:09:23 2007 -0800
@@ -34,6 +34,8 @@
 
   GtkWidget *canvas;
   gint x,y;
+
+  GList *widget_list;
 };
 
 struct _SkinnedWindowClass
@@ -42,5 +44,8 @@
 };
 
 extern GtkWidget *ui_skinned_window_new(GtkWindowType type);
+extern void ui_skinned_window_widgetlist_associate(GtkWidget * widget, Widget * w);
+extern void ui_skinned_window_widgetlist_dissociate(GtkWidget * widget, Widget * w);
+extern gboolean ui_skinned_window_widgetlist_contained(GtkWidget * widget, gint x, gint y);
 
 #endif